Traditional surge protectors face two main issues during disconnection: 1. Insufficient disconnection distance; 2. Formation of a filament state after disconnection, meaning they do not fully disconnect from the circuit and are prone to catching fire.
Surge Protection Device SPD exhibits wire drawing after the trip

Corresponding Solution

LSP's carefully designed flat disconnection device forms an independent chamber upon disconnection.

Results

This design effectively isolates and extinguishes arcs, preventing SPD fires from damaging distribution cabinets. It ensures complete isolation of both electrodes, effectively preventing solder filaments and arc generation.
